Building and construction Bonds


Construction Bonds are a method to secure the project owner from monetary losses and make sure that the professional finishes the job on schedule. They are often used on public tasks such as facilities and ports.

A Building Bond is issued by a surety bond agency, which runs substantial history and financial checks on the service provider before accepting the bond. If the professional stops working to follow the terms of the contract, the obligee can make a claim against the building bond.

The building and construction bond is made to offer economic assurance that the project will be completed in a timely manner as well as with the best quality criteria. Nonetheless, it can also be used to recuperate losses caused by a personal bankruptcy or a professional's failing to follow the regards to their agreement.

Court Bonds


Court bonds are judicial guaranty bonds utilized to ensure protection from loss in court proceedings. They can be needed by plaintiffs as well as accuseds in cases including home, estates or fiduciary responsibility.

The primary objective of court bonds is to lower risk, which includes the opportunity of one party taking care of opposed residential property before the outcome of the situation has actually been rendered and also the opportunity of court sets you back not being paid. Furthermore, court-appointed caretakers are typically needed to get a fiduciary bond to guarantee that they execute their responsibilities morally and also comply with the demands of the court.

There are a number of sorts of court bonds, each serving a certain function and also with special underwriting requirements. Insurance coverage agents can assist consumers obtain the appropriate court bond at the very best price by informing them concerning the various types of court bonds as well as their underwriting requirements.

Probate Bonds


Probate Bonds (likewise called fiduciary bonds, estate bonds, and executor bonds) are made use of to make certain that the person assigned to implement a will performs their obligations in a legal way. Failing to do so may lead to economic loss for the successors of the estate.

Probates are court-supervised procedures that distribute the properties of a deceased person among their heirs. Typically this process is detailed in the person's will.

In some states, a personal representative of an estate is called for to buy a probate bond.
